From 8d4401b9b092d692302f5ce289a74bef86eb991a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: tuexen Date: Thu, 20 Jun 2019 12:38:41 +0000 Subject: [PATCH] The variable names in the description of the port number usage is inconsistent. This patch fixes that and improves the precision of the description. Thanks to Tom Marcoen for reporting the issue and providing an initial patch, on which this change is based.
